Definitions ofvessel
- Any craft designed for transportation on water, such as a ship or boat.
- A craft designed for transportation through air or space.
- Dishes and cutlery collectively, especially if made of precious metals.
- A container of liquid or other substance, such as a glass, goblet, cup, bottle, bowl, or pitcher.
- A person as a container of qualities or feelings.
- A tube or canal that carries fluid in an animal or plant.
Example: "Blood and lymph vessels are found in humans; xylem and phloem vessels are found in plants."
- To put into a vessel.
